Saudi, Tajik MMA Federations Sign Landmark Partnership Agreement

Saudi, Tajik MMA Federations Sign Landmark Partnership Agreement

The Saudi Mixed Martial Arts Federation has signed a memorandum of understanding (MoU) with the Tajikistan Mixed Martial Arts Federation (TAJMMAF) to enhance cooperation in developing the combat sport in both Saudi Arabia and Tajikistan. The agreement, signed on August 13, 2024, in Riyadh, underscores the Kingdom’s commitment to expanding international sports partnerships as part of its broader Vision 2030 goals. Saudi Mixed Martial Arts Federation Chief Executive Abdullah Alhazzaa and TAJMMAF Executive Director Khushmakhmad Pirov formalized the pact, which aims to foster mutual growth and expertise exchange.

Key Details

The agreement covers a range of collaborative activities, including the exchange of expertise among technical departments, sharing documents, information, and instructional materials. It also facilitates the participation of sports delegations from both nations in combat sports events. Additionally, the MoU includes cooperation in training and organizing conferences, seminars, workshops, and cultural and educational events. The signatories emphasized that the partnership would enhance the technical and administrative capabilities of both federations, contributing to the development of MMA in their respective countries.
